Ordinals
beta
Sat 1343513307680889
decimal
327405.807680889
degree
0°117405′813″807680889‴
percentile
63.97682424565496%
name
eihnhlfggai
cycle
0
epoch
1
period
162
block
327405
offset
807680889
timestamp
2014-10-28 19:47:02 UTC
rarity
common
prev
next